The world of cinema recently lost one of its most reliable and resonant voices. Bill Cobbs, the veteran character actor whose weathered face and soulful delivery became a staple of American film and television, passed away at his home in California at the age of 90. Known for a career that spanned half a century, Cobbs was the quintessential “actor’s actor”—the kind of performer who didn’t just play a role, but anchored every scene he touched with a profound sense of humanity and quiet dignity.

His passing on June 25 marks the end of a remarkable journey that began far from the bright lights of Hollywood. A native of Cleveland, Ohio, Cobbs didn’t even start his professional acting career until his late 30s, having previously served in the Air Force and worked for IBM. That life experience translated into a screen presence that felt earned rather than practiced. Whether he was playing the wise mentor, the weary bluesman, or the stern but loving father figure, there was an unmistakable authenticity to his work that drew audiences in.

The news of his death was shared by his brother, Pastor Thomas G. Cobbs, who spoke of the family’s grief balanced by a deep sense of gratitude for the long, meaningful life Bill led. To his family, he was a pillar of faith and a gentle soul; to his colleagues, he was a consummate professional who treated every member of a film crew with the same respect he showed his directors.

For fans, the loss feels surprisingly personal. Cobbs had a unique ability to make the audience feel like they knew him. In The Bodyguard, he provided the necessary gravitas; in Night at the Museum, he brought a mischievous, seasoned energy; and in New Jack City, he delivered a performance of searing moral clarity. He was rarely the name above the title, but he was frequently the heart of the story. His filmography is a masterclass in the art of the supporting performance—proving that there are no small parts, only actors who fail to find the soul within them. Bill Cobbs never failed to find that soul.
